WebYou can use the -p (pattern) option to cause less to search through the text file and find the first matching item. It will then display the page with the matching search item in it, instead of the first page of the file. This backend can be used to trigger test cases for I2C bus masters which require a remote device with certain capabilities (and which are usually not so easy to obtain). Examples include multi-master testing, and SMBus Host Notify testing.
